    Sweet!!! It's so awesome. And it's worth the 2.5 hour drive - the trail itself is something like 12 miles long. It's gotten harder over the years, as stuff gets rutted and the rocks get more exposed. It makes for an amazing day! I love it too, because it's not cliffy. It's gulchy. No one's dying from falling off the edge. Like, oh, you know, Saxon above Georgetown. If I never drive that again, it'll be too soon.
